]> git.lizzy.rs Git - rust.git/blobdiff - src/librustc_resolve/error_codes.rs
Rollup merge of #61441 - estebank:fn-call-in-match, r=varkor
[rust.git] / src / librustc_resolve / error_codes.rs
index 5c095994a1bbd422f3a55d4b883b7de11db6ec37..7cd26dce1447c9d93657a3d87498458f0eb3ce52 100644 (file)
@@ -1642,6 +1642,19 @@ fn main() {
 ```
 "##,
 
+E0671: r##"
+Const parameters cannot depend on type parameters.
+The following is therefore invalid:
+```compile_fail,E0671
+#![feature(const_generics)]
+
+fn const_id<T, const N: T>() -> T { // error: const parameter
+                                    // depends on type parameter
+    N
+}
+```
+"##,
+
 }
 
 register_diagnostics! {